Previously, I had Nero 6.3.0.2 and INCD 4.1.0.0 installed in Win 2000, however, that resulted in the server not found error referenced in a number of postings in this forum.

I recently replaced that installation with Nero 6.3.0.3 and INCD 4.1.5.7.

The server error is gone but there are at least the following problems:

1. INCD icon is not in system tray.

2. Although I can copy/drag files to the CD-RW drive, there are not Format or Erase items when I right-click on the drive in My Computer, there are no INCD entries in the drive's properties and the Eject menu item, though present, does not work.

3. Likely related, but mindboggling is the following.

As I have stated several times over many months, EasyWrite Reader (EWR) version 4 does not support all the drives supported by EWR 3, including some popular drives, a list of which seems to be included in the windows registry.

Because of this, I have to install EWR 3, instead of EWR 4. When I tried this yesterday, I got the following message,:

Title bar: "InCD EasyWrite Reader Installer"

Message body: "InCD EasyWrite Reader works under Windows 95/98/ME/2000/XP only."

Well, all I have is windows 2000.

This indicates that the installation program is not properly requesting identification from the OS.
